The UAE's rapid industrial growth — particularly in food processing, FMCG manufacturing, hospitality, and pharmaceuticals — has created strong demand for reliable, compact, and high-quality effluent treatment systems that meet the stringent requirements of Dubai Municipality (DM), Abu Dhabi's Environment Agency (EAD), and free zone regulators such as Trakhees and JAFZA.

Industrial wastewater in the UAE must be treated before discharge to the municipal sewer network under UAE.S 885, which sets limits for BOD (<30 mg/L), COD (<250 mg/L), TSS (<100 mg/L), oil and grease (<10 mg/L), and pH (6–9). Surface water discharge limits under UAE.S 999 are more stringent. Free zone operating licences are typically conditional on effluent compliance, and periodic third-party effluent testing is mandatory. Non-compliant discharge can result in fines, licence suspension, and facility closure.

UAE's water scarcity context makes water reuse a significant driver alongside compliance. Treated wastewater reclaimed for irrigation, cooling tower makeup, or toilet flushing reduces operating costs and supports sustainability reporting obligations. Spans designs treatment systems with water reuse in mind — producing tertiary-quality effluent that meets Abu Dhabi Irrigation Standards (ADWEC) or Dubai Municipality recycled water quality standards.

Industry Challenges

Key Environmental Challenges

Stringent Local Authority Standards

Dubai Municipality UAE.S 885 and Abu Dhabi EAD effluent quality conditions are stricter than Indian CPCB standards in some parameters. Systems must be engineered for consistent compliance — not just average performance — as quarterly third-party audits form the basis of licence renewal.

Space Constraints in Industrial Zones

Industrial plots in JAFZA, Dubai Industrial City, KIZAD, and Sharjah Industrial Area are typically compact. Wastewater treatment systems must be designed for minimal footprint — driving preference for MBBR over conventional activated sludge, MBR over secondary clarifiers, and packaged containerised units over traditional civil construction.

High-Temperature Operation

UAE ambient temperatures (25–48°C) significantly affect biological treatment kinetics. MBBR and MBR systems operating at elevated temperatures require careful aeration design, dissolved oxygen management, and membrane fouling control to maintain consistent performance. Sludge dewatering and drying systems must also account for high ambient temperature.

Variable Food Industry Effluent

Food processing and FMCG plants in UAE's free zones generate effluent with high and variable BOD (500–8,000 mg/L), FOG from frying and dairy operations, and pH swings from CIP chemical cleaning. Treatment systems must be designed for peak-load handling and include equalisation, DAF, biological treatment, and tertiary polishing.

Water Reuse Regulatory Requirements

Abu Dhabi's regulatory framework and Dubai's environmental policies increasingly require industrial users to demonstrate water conservation and reuse. Treated wastewater for irrigation or cooling must meet specific quality standards (Abu Dhabi Class A, B, or C recycled water) requiring tertiary treatment including UV disinfection or chlorination.

Our Solutions

Tailored Wastewater Treatment Solutions

Packaged ETP Systems — Factory-Built, CIF UAE

Containerised and skid-mounted ETPs assembled and tested in Spans' India facilities, shipped CIF to Jebel Ali, Khalifa Port, or other UAE ports. Covers 5–200 m³/day flow range. Includes primary screening, physio-chemical treatment, biological treatment (MBBR or extended aeration), clarification, and tertiary filtration. Minimises on-site civil work and commissioning risk.

Dissolved Air Flotation (DAF) for Food & Hospitality

High-efficiency DAF systems for FOG removal from food court drains, hotel kitchens, food processing effluent, and catering facility wastewater. Polyelectrolyte/coagulant dosing removes fats, oils, greases, and suspended solids before sewer discharge or biological treatment. Available 5–500+ m³/hr. Compact design with stainless steel construction for food-grade environments.

MBBR Biological Treatment

Moving Bed Biofilm Reactor (MBBR) technology delivers compact, robust aerobic biological treatment for UAE industrial clients. MBBR handles variable loads and temperature fluctuations better than conventional activated sludge. High biomass concentration in a compact reactor volume makes MBBR ideal for free zone plots with space restrictions.

MBR Systems for Water Reuse

Membrane Bioreactor (MBR) produces permeate quality suitable for reuse in cooling towers, boiler makeup, toilet flushing, or landscaping — meeting Abu Dhabi and Dubai recycled water standards with UV disinfection. Compact footprint, no secondary clarifier required. TSS in permeate typically <1 mg/L, suitable for direct reuse applications.

Sewage Treatment Plants (STP) for Commercial Developments

STP systems for hotels, resorts, commercial complexes, and residential developments in UAE. Designed to produce effluent suitable for irrigation reuse or sewer discharge per Dubai Municipality guidelines. MBBR-based or SBR-based STPs designed for the populations and flows of each development, with automated operation suited to facilities management teams.

ZLD Systems for Export-Oriented Manufacturers

For UAE manufacturers with stringent licence conditions or zero-discharge requirements, Spans offers end-to-end ZLD systems integrating RO with MEE or MVR evaporation. Achieves >95% water recovery. Particularly relevant for pharmaceutical, chemical, and speciality food manufacturers operating in UAE free zones under strict environmental licence conditions.
